Applicable Range of Products
The SI5335A-B08180-GMR is suitable for applications that require precise clock generation and multiplication. It can be used in various industries, including telecommunications, networking, industrial automation, and consumer electronics.
Working Principles
The SI5335A-B08180-GMR utilizes a phase-locked loop (PLL) to generate and multiply the input clock signal. The PLL locks onto the input frequency and generates multiple output clocks with programmable frequencies. The device also incorporates low-jitter circuitry to ensure accurate timing.
